Queensland Floods

Beginning in December 2010, a series of floods affected Australia, primarily the state of Queensland, and forced the evacuations of thousands of people from their homes. Three quarters of Queensland were declared a disaster zone, leaving 35 people dead and declared 9 missing. The damage to Australia’s GDP is said to be A$ 30 billion. In order to provide situational awareness to reconstruction activities in severely flood affected communities imagery was captured by the ICE Team using the Leica ADS40 Airborne Digital Sensor.
